As the Senior Change Manager, you will lead the empowerment of colleagues to embrace the changes introduced through strategic transformation initiatives, driving adoption of the processes, tools, and ways of working. You will have the opportunity to lead the engagement, and ongoing embedding and adoption of our Gen AI too, Elysia and other AI initiatives. Key Responsibilities Develop Change Management Strategies: lead the design and delivery of end‑to‑end change management strategies to drive behavioural change and embed new roles and ways of working, processes and tools. Manage and coach a team of Change Managers and Change Analysts. Stakeholder Engagement: identify and analyse key stakeholders impacted by changes, and create tailored engagement plans to address their concerns, expectations, and communication needs. Change Impact Assessment: conduct thorough assessments to understand the impact of the change on various departments, teams, and individuals. Use findings to inform change management approaches. Communication Planning: design and implement effective communication plans to ensure clear, consistent, and timely messaging about the change, its rationale, and its benefits. Create a persuasive case for change, producing communication and engagement materials and owning communications to stakeholders. Ensure all materials are designed and produced in a timely manner and align to wider messages. Change Readiness: evaluate the organisation's readiness for change, identifying potential obstacles and areas requiring additional support or training. Training and Development: identify education and training requirements to equip employees with the skills and knowledge needed to adapt to the change effectively. Work closely with the Learning & Development Team to develop suitable solutions. Coordinate and deliver training programmes. Resistance Management: proactively identify and address sources of resistance to change, implementing strategies to overcome barriers and foster a positive change experience. Monitoring and Evaluation: continuously monitor change progress, gather feedback, and measure the effectiveness of change management efforts. Make data‑driven adjustments as necessary. Risk Management: identify potential risks and challenges associated with the change process and develop risk mitigation plans to ensure a smooth transition. Leadership Support: provide guidance and support to team leaders throughout the change process, enabling them to effectively lead their teams through transformation. Organisational Culture: promote a culture of change readiness and adaptability, fostering a supportive environment for ongoing transformation. Sustaining Change: ensure that change efforts lead to lasting, positive outcomes, and work to embed changes into the organisation's culture. Leverage appropriate change management methodology, process, and tools to create a strategy to support adoption of the changes required, whilst working in a highly federated, complex and international business.
